Skip to content

attempting to take items out of a shulker box in the inventory using easy shulker boxes crashes the game #88

@veccyboi

Description

@veccyboi

Describe the bug

i use a mod called easy shulker boxes (https://modrinth.com/mod/easy-shulker-boxes), which allows you to hover over a shulker box in your inventory and take items out of it without placing the box down. recently, i upgraded all my create addons (including petrol's parts and petrolpark library) to create 6.0.8. however, this has now caused the game to crash whenever i try to take items out of an in-inventory shulker box using easy shulker boxes.

i highly suspect that petrolpark's library may have something to do here, as:

  1. this did not happen in a nearly identical backup modpack with petrolpark v 1.4.11
  2. petrolpark's library is mentioned as a suspected mod in the crash report

To Reproduce

  1. install petrolpark library 1.4.23 and easy shulker boxes 8.0.2 for forge 47.4.0
  2. load into a world, get a shulker box and put something into it. break the shulker box and pick it up. hover over the box to bring up the menu showing what items are inside. scroll to the slot with the thing you put inside and try to right-click to take it out.
  3. game crashes with a NullPointerException

Expected Behavior

the item gets taken out without crashing.

System Information

full modlist: chosen's modded adventure with immptl create v6.0.8 test.html

Additional context

debug.log (as a google drive file since it's too big to fit in mclogs or upload here): https://drive.google.com/file/d/1YM3DdjIZ79E1SYxiSTS--p4s425t01el/view?usp=sharing
crash report: https://mclo.gs/78lhRAy
the crash report does also list quark and zeta as suspected mods, but i'm not sure if they have anything to do with this issue, as this issue is not present when using petrolpark library 1.4.11 and their versions did not change at all when i upgraded the modpack.

Metadata

Metadata

Assignees

No one assigned

    Labels

    ⌛ Outdated Version OnlyBug is not present in 1.21.1, which is the only properly supported version. Low-priority to fix.🐛 BugSomething isn't working as intended🤝 CompatibilityBugs and suggestions related to compatibility with other mods

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ions